Stop Routine Legal Requests From Filling Lawyers' Queues

Summary

Low-value legal requests become expensive when they arrive as unstructured emails, chat messages, and repeat questions. Lawyers then spend time finding missing facts, answering policy questions repeatedly, assigning work, and providing status updates instead of focusing on risk and high-impact matters. The right answer is legal workflow software that creates a single front door for requests, resolves appropriate questions through self-service, and sends the remainder through a consistent triage process.
